Position Summary
The Registered Nurse (RN) is responsible for providing and coordinating nursing care for residents in a skilled nursing facility in accordance with applicable laws, regulations, and facility policies. The RN ensures quality clinical outcomes, supervises nursing staff, and promotes a safe and therapeutic environment for residents.
Essential Duties and Responsibilities
- Assess, plan, implement, and evaluate resident care in accordance with individualized care plans and physician orders
- Perform ongoing resident assessments and document clinical findings accurately and timely
- Administer medications and treatments in compliance with facility protocols and regulatory standards
- Monitor resident conditions and promptly report significant changes to physicians and the interdisciplinary team
- Supervise and direct the activities of Licensed Practical Nurses (LPNs) and Certified Nursing Assistants (CNAs)
- Participate in care plan development, updates, and interdisciplinary team meetings
- Ensure compliance with federal, state, and local regulations, including infection control and safety standards
- Maintain accurate and complete medical records in the electronic medical record system
- Respond to emergencies and provide appropriate clinical interventions
- Assist with admissions, transfers, and discharges as needed
- Communicate effectively with residents, families, physicians, and staff
